Community Service (PkM) aims to provide education and capacity building to foster children at the orphanage regarding the basic principles of company management. As a for-profit institution, rather than a non-profit social institution, its management requires a systematic managerial approach to run effectively, efficiently, and sustainably. Through this (PkM), it is hoped that they will be able to understand basic concepts such as planning, organizing, leadership, and control as part of good governance practices. The method of implementation of the activity is counseling or interactive lectures involving all children and the orphanage administrators. The material is delivered verbally and visually using presentation media, accompanied by question and answer sessions and case studies to make it more applicable and easy to understand. A participatory approach is used so that participants are active in discussions and can relate the material to real situations at the orphanage. The results of the activity show an increase in the knowledge of foster children and orphanage administrators regarding the basic concepts of company management, particularly regarding the importance of activity planning, division of roles and tasks, and transparent financial records. Participants stated that this activity provided new insights that can be directly applied in the day-to-day management of the orphanage. This activity also builds awareness that the application of managerial principles is not only relevant for business companies, but also for social institutions in achieving their humanitarian goals in a sustainable manner.
